At Farnborough (Main), you’ll find an array of facilities designed to ease your travel experience. The ticket office at the station is open from 06:10 to 20: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 07:40 to 21:00 on Sundays, ensuring you have ample time to purchase or collect pre-booked tickets. Smartcard users can take advantage of smartcard validators and ticket machines are readily accessible for all customers, including those benefiting from a Disabled Persons Railcard. An induction loop is installed to assist those with hearing impairments.
The station offers step-free access to all platforms and features ticket barriers and gates. While there are no accessible toilets or baby-changing facilities, toilets are available on Platform 2. For individuals who require assistance, trained staff are present on-site, and customer help points are available for additional support. Regular commuters will appreciate the seating areas, while biking enthusiasts can utilize the 346 bicycle storage spaces available.
The station forecourt, located off Union Street, acts as a central point for all rail replacement services. Additionally, there are connections to local bus services to facilitate easier onward journeys. At Gordon Hill station, you can buy and collect your tickets at the convenience of ticket machines available on site, which support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. The ticket office is open from 06:35 to 13:00 on weekdays, and slightly later on Saturdays, from 07:45 to 14:10. Smartcard holders will find validators and issuance services readily available here. If you require some assistance, while customer help points are not installed, you can find staff support at designated help points and CCTV is operational across the station premises for enhanced security.
Accessibility may pose a challenge as the station falls under Category C, meaning there is no step-free access and ramps for train access aren't provided. If assistance is needed, it is advisable to arrive at least 20 minutes prior to your journey to ensure timely help. Although there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, the seating area is available, allowing for some respite.
Gordon Hill is well-connected for those looking to continue their journey beyond the station. Information on local bus services is easily accessible with an Onward Travel Information Map, ensuring seamless transition to your next mode of conveyance. Although cycle hire isn’t possible, sheltered and CCTV-monitored bicycle storage is available, allowing travelers to park their bikes securely at the station entrance.
